Article in McDonogh Magazine

In early 2013 I returned to my high school to speak with students about my experience working on a presidential campaign, how I learned to like math, and American politics.

The school magazine wrote up this article on the visit.

"Peter Backof ’02 admits that when he was in Upper School at McDonogh he wasn’t really motivated by math, which is why his job crunching numbers as a member of the Obama Campaign seems somewhat ironic. Backof returned to campus this week to share his experiences and explain how life after McDonogh led him to the 2012 presidential campaign."
